The Nitty-Gritty on Heat and Fit Glass art is all about precision. If the heat is off, the piece is ruined. We build our lamps to match your exact voltage and wattage, so you aren’t fighting with your power supply. If your machine is a tight squeeze, we’ll mill the quartz tubes to the exact length you need. One quick tip: if you go for high-wattage density to get those fast ramp-up times, just double-check your cooling fans. You don’t want heat building up in the housing, or you’ll burn through your new lamp way too fast. Materials That Actually Work We use high-purity quartz and halogen gas. Why? Because it creates shortwave infrared. Instead of just scorching the surface of the glass, the heat actually sinks in. As for the install, it’s a breeze. We use standard R7s or SK15 connectors. They’re basically drop-in replacements. You won’t have to mess with your wiring or tear apart the machine chassis. And if your specific art needs a softer touch, let us know. We can apply special coatings to the tube to tweak the heat gradient. Keeping Your Glass Intact The goal is to get the glass workable without causing it to crack from thermal shock. By dialing in the wattage per centimeter, we keep the heat flow steady. This means your glass makes the jump to the blowing or molding stage without any nasty surprises.
